8. Financial Investigations
Financial Investigations refers to investigations conducted to determine the movement of money within a company or personal bank account. These investigations may be used to determine a number of financial crimes, such as embezzlement, money laundering, tax evasion, corporate theft, and fraud. Financial investigations may also be called forensic accounting.
